"Dylan Speak" by ONEANDLONELY

You held back the curtains,
watched your fine china fall,
through the spectrum,
and down to the floor.
Toss back your hair,
drown your sorrow.
Leave it behind.
Step through the door

The jailer holds the dreams,
deep in his front pocket,
key to the cells,
he keeps men locked in.
 End of the day,
 the key's with him,
he needs those dreams,
 makes his world spin.

They built the lord's chapel
on the top of the hill,
In the damp ground,
lay the coffins still.
Mourning the dead,
 memories fade,
hoard their jewels,
 fortunes in wills.

 The farmer lays the plow
 to the dirt in the field.
Blood on the blade
 and crops it will yield.
Late in the nite,
full moon rays shine,
onto his bed,
his pride revealed.

Send to me your tired.
I will make them the poor.
 Destiny's child
will grow up a whore.
No chance for pearls,
or take-out food,
Alone from birth,
the rain shall pour.

Look at lesbians
as they sneer at the gay.
They look like men,
it's a game they play
Amazon girls,
their strength they boast,
but wear a dress,
oh, yay, no way.

An old priest saw the light
and bowed down before it.
 The poet, knew light,
and rose before it.
Many people
 try to covet.
Their words are lies ,
 rise above it.

What is the beginning
 of the end of the earth?
Storms and hunger,
or the virgin birth?

When we all die,
we are re-born.

Our slate wiped clean
 of human worth
